A Programmable Logic Controller (PLC) is a digital computer that uses programmable memory to store instructions and implement specific functions to control industrial processes. PLCs are designed to operate in real-time, interacting with physical devices such as sensors, actuators, and other control systems. Their primary function is to monitor and control industrial processes, ensuring efficient, reliable, and safe operation.
